The Role of IT Audits in Achieving Regulatory Compliance in UK

In today’s data-driven economy, regulatory compliance is not optional—it’s a business imperative. With frameworks like GDPR and ISO 27001 setting clear expectations for how organizations manage data and information security, businesses must be proactive in ensuring their systems, processes, and teams are aligned with these standards. This is where IT Audits play a critical role. By providing a structured, systematic evaluation of an organization’s IT infrastructure and policies, IT audits help uncover risks, enforce accountability, and serve as a foundation for long-term compliance. In this blog, we’ll explore how IT audits support regulatory goals, what they typically include, and how they contribute to achieving and maintaining compliance with standards like GDPR and ISO 27001. Why IT Audits Are Essential for Regulatory Compliance 1. They Provide a Baseline Assessment Before an organization can comply with standards like GDPR or ISO 27001, it must understand its current level of risk and security maturity. IT audits help identify: Gaps in data protection controls Unencrypted or unclassified sensitive data Misconfigured access rights or outdated permissions Missing policies and procedures This audit-driven insight forms the starting point for implementing compliance programs. 2. They Ensure Controls Are in Place and Working Regulations don’t just require documentation—they demand that controls be actively enforced. IT audits test the effectiveness of: Encryption protocols Access control mechanisms Backup and recovery processes Logging and monitoring tools Auditors validate whether policies are truly implemented in practice—not just written on paper. 3. They Support Continuous Improvement Both GDPR and ISO 27001 emphasize ongoing risk assessment and improvement. Regular IT audits provide the recurring checkpoints needed to: Monitor compliance efforts Evaluate new threats and system changes Keep policies and configurations up to date This ensures that compliance is not a one-time achievement but a sustained effort. IT Audits and GDPR: A Closer Look The General Data Protection Regulation (GDPR) mandates that organisations safeguard personal data and uphold individuals’ privacy rights. IT audits help address key GDPR requirements such as: Lawful processing: Audits verify whether personal data is collected and processed with valid legal bases. Data minimisation and retention: Audits ensure only necessary data is retained and that retention periods are enforced. Access control: Audits test that access to personal data is limited to authorized personnel. Breach detection and response: IT audits assess incident detection capabilities and breach notification protocols. GDPR also encourages data protection impact assessments (DPIAs)—which share many similarities with IT audit frameworks. IT Audits and ISO 27001: A Closer Look ISO/IEC 27001 is an international standard for information security management systems (ISMS). IT audits are central to achieving and maintaining ISO 27001 certification. Key ISO 27001 areas supported by IT audits include: Risk assessment and treatment: Identifying vulnerabilities and implementing mitigations. Policy enforcement: Ensuring that documented information security policies are followed across departments. Asset management: Verifying that all information assets are inventoried and protected. Access controls and segregation of duties: Ensuring that users have appropriate access rights. Monitoring and logging: Auditing whether security events are logged, reviewed, and responded to. Internal audits are also a mandatory clause in ISO 27001 (Clause 9.2), requiring organizations to perform regular reviews of their ISMS. What to Include in an IT Audit for Compliance A well-rounded IT audit for GDPR or ISO 27001 compliance typically includes: Review of network architecture and firewall configurations Assessment of data classification and encryption measures Analysis of user access and role-based permissions Evaluation of backup and disaster recovery plans Review of incident response policies and breach reporting procedures Examination of vendor and third-party security practices Validation of policy documentation and employee training programs Final Thoughts Whether you’re preparing for certification, responding to regulatory changes, or simply tightening your security posture, IT audits are a foundational element of compliance. They offer clarity, structure, and measurable insight into how well your organization manages information risk. For businesses navigating GDPR, ISO 27001, or other regulatory frameworks, regular IT audits are not just a best practice—they’re a strategic necessity. CIO vs. CTO: What’s the Difference Between These Two Roles?

As organizations scale and mature, technology leadership becomes essential. But when it comes to hiring or working with tech executives, many businesses ask: What’s the Difference Between CIO and CTO? Though both roles sit at the top of the IT hierarchy, their focus, responsibilities, and strategic goals differ significantly. Understanding the distinctions between CIO vs. CTO helps clarify who should lead internal IT operations versus who should drive innovation and product development. This guide explores the roles side-by-side—highlighting their core duties, reporting lines, and where they overlap or diverge. Defining the Roles: CIO vs. CTO What Is a CIO (Chief Information Officer)? A Chief Information Officer (CIO) is primarily focused on the organization’s internal IT systems. They are responsible for ensuring the company’s technology infrastructure supports operational efficiency and aligns with overall business objectives. Key CIO responsibilities include: Managing enterprise IT infrastructure and internal support Overseeing systems like CRM, ERP, and cloud services Aligning IT strategy with business goals Ensuring data security, compliance, and governance Leading digital transformation within the business What Is a CTO (Chief Technology Officer)? A Chief Technology Officer (CTO), on the other hand, is focused on external-facing technology. Their role is to leverage innovation to build products, platforms, or services that deliver value to customers and drive revenue. Key CTO responsibilities include: Overseeing technology product development Driving R&D and adoption of emerging technologies Enhancing customer experience through tech innovation Leading engineering or software development teams Creating long-term technology roadmaps CIO vs. CTO: Side-by-Side Comparison Criteria CIO (Chief Information Officer) CTO (Chief Technology Officer) Primary Focus Internal systems, operations, and IT efficiency Product innovation and external technology Strategic Objective Operational optimization and compliance Customer engagement and tech innovation Team Oversight IT infrastructure, helpdesk, security Engineering, R&D, product teams Reports To CEO, COO, or CFO Often CEO, sometimes CIO or CPO Tech Stack Focus Enterprise systems (ERP, CRM, M365) Product stack, software development Business Goal Streamline operations, reduce risk Drive growth through tech-led services Collaboration Between CIOs and CTOs In many mid-sized and enterprise organizations, CIOs and CTOs work closely together. While the CIO ensures the internal systems are scalable and secure, the CTO focuses on leveraging tech to innovate externally. Examples of collaboration include: Ensuring internal IT can support new product deployments Coordinating security policies and compliance across systems Sharing resources for development and infrastructure needs Aligning infrastructure decisions with long-term tech goals When CIOs and CTOs communicate well, businesses benefit from better alignment between backend operations and customer-facing innovation. When Do You Need a CIO or CTO? Understanding when to hire a CTO vs. CIO depends on your business model and growth stage. Hire a CIO when: You need to modernize internal IT systems Data governance, compliance, or security are priorities Your IT operations are fragmented and need central leadership Hire a CTO when: You develop technology products or platforms Your business relies on tech to deliver services to customers Innovation and R&D are critical to your growth strategy Hire both roles when: You are scaling rapidly and need clear ownership of both internal IT and external product development You want to balance operational stability with innovation Real-World Examples of CTO and CIO Roles A CIO may lead a full infrastructure upgrade, cloud migration, or deployment of enterprise software across departments. A CTO might oversee the development of a SaaS product, mobile app, or platform integrations with third-party vendors. In smaller companies, one person may wear both hats. As the business grows, separating the CIO and CTO roles ensures clarity, accountability, and strategic alignment. Final Thoughts: CTO vs. CIO So, What’s the difference between CIO and CTO? The CIO focuses on enabling the business through efficient internal systems and secure infrastructure. The CTO focuses on using technology to innovate, build, and scale market-facing products or services. Understanding the differences between CIO vs CTO roles helps organizations structure leadership more effectively and align their IT and business strategies. How IT Helpdesks Can Implement Zero Trust Security Frameworks

As cyber threats grow in sophistication and remote work becomes the norm, traditional perimeter-based security models are no longer sufficient. In response, many organizations are shifting toward a Zero Trust security framework—a model based on the principle of “never trust, always verify.” While Zero Trust is often led by security architects and infrastructure teams, IT helpdesks play a vital, hands-on role in its implementation and enforcement. From managing user identities to verifying device health, helpdesk teams are on the front lines of operationalizing Zero Trust principles. In this blog, we’ll explore the core elements of Zero Trust, the helpdesk’s role in each, and actionable steps to integrate these strategies into daily support operations. What Is Zero Trust Security? Zero Trust is a security model that assumes no user, device, or network—internal or external—should be trusted by default. Access must be continuously verified based on user identity, device posture, location, and behavior. The core components of Zero Trust include: Strong Identity Verification Least Privilege Access Continuous Monitoring Micro-Segmentation Adaptive Authentication The goal is to limit the blast radius of breaches and reduce unauthorized access to critical systems, even if an attacker penetrates one layer of defense. Why Helpdesks Are Crucial to Zero Trust While Zero Trust may be a strategic initiative, its execution often falls to the IT helpdesk, which handles: User provisioning and de-provisioning Access management Endpoint verification First-line support for identity and authentication issues Device compliance and patching workflows Their daily interactions with users and systems make helpdesk technicians key enforcers of Zero Trust controls. Key Areas Where Helpdesks Support Zero Trust Security Identity and Access Management (IAM) Helpdesk teams manage the creation and removal of user accounts, group memberships, and permissions. To align with Zero Trust: Use role-based access control (RBAC) to enforce least privilege Regularly review and audit permissions Automate onboarding/offboarding workflows to reduce delays and human error Multi-Factor Authentication (MFA) Support Zero Trust mandates strong authentication. The helpdesk must: Enforce MFA enrollment during onboarding Provide support for MFA issues (e.g., lost tokens, reset requests) Educate users on safe MFA practices Device Posture Verification Access should only be granted to compliant, secure devices. Helpdesk responsibilities include: Ensuring endpoint protection software is installed and up to date Verifying device encryption and OS patch status Supporting secure remote access tools and VPNs Tools like Microsoft Intune or Jamf can automate device compliance checks, with helpdesk staff ensuring these systems function smoothly. Incident Response and Alert Escalation Helpdesks are often the first to detect suspicious activity—failed logins, unusual access patterns, or user-reported anomalies. Key actions include: Monitoring for indicators of compromise Escalating alerts to security teams Assisting with initial containment steps (account lockout, device quarantine) User Education and Phishing Response Users are a common target for cyberattacks. Helpdesk teams can promote security awareness by: Educating users on phishing detection and safe password practices Responding quickly to reported phishing emails or credential theft Enforcing periodic security training Automation and Workflow Integration Zero Trust thrives on consistent, policy-driven responses. Helpdesks can use automation to enforce security standards: Auto-lock inactive accounts after a defined period Trigger access re-certification workflows Use self-service portals for common tasks like password resets, with built-in verification steps Best Practices for Helpdesks in a Zero Trust Model Standardize account creation and permission assignment Document and automate access approval workflows Conduct regular audits of user roles, devices, and access logs Implement ticket categorization for security-related incidents Maintain strong collaboration with security, networking, and compliance teams Tools That Support Zero Trust Implementation Helpdesks can leverage tools like: Azure Active Directory for conditional access policies Okta or Duo Security for identity management and MFA ServiceNow or Freshservice for automated workflows and compliance reporting Endpoint Detection & Response (EDR) solutions for device-level monitoring These platforms allow helpdesks to operate within Zero Trust frameworks more effectively and securely. Final Thoughts Zero Trust isn’t a single product—it’s a mindset shift. For it to succeed, every part of your IT operation must be involved, especially the helpdesk. By adopting best practices around access control, device compliance, and incident response, helpdesk teams play an essential role in reducing attack surfaces and enforcing Zero Trust principles day to day. As organizations grow increasingly digital and decentralized, aligning your IT helpdesk with Zero Trust frameworks is both a practical necessity and a strategic advantage. IT Helpdesk Job Description: What to Expect in Your First Role

Starting your career in IT support? An IT helpdesk role is often the first step for many professionals entering the tech industry. It’s a dynamic, fast-paced position that builds the foundational skills required for a broad range of IT careers, from network administration to cybersecurity and beyond. But what exactly does an IT helpdesk technician do? What should you expect in your first job, and how can you prepare to succeed? In this post, we’ll break down a typical IT Service Desk job description, explore the daily responsibilities, and outline the skills employers are looking for. What Does an IT Helpdesk Expert Do? An IT helpdesk technician is responsible for providing technical support to users experiencing hardware, software, or network-related issues. They act as the first point of contact for troubleshooting problems and ensuring smooth IT operations. Helpdesk roles typically fall under Tier 1 support, dealing with basic or routine issues, but they offer exposure to a wide range of systems and technologies. Core Responsibilities of an IT Helpdesk Technician Here’s what a typical IT Service Desk job description might include: 1. Troubleshooting and Resolving Technical Issues Diagnosing and resolving hardware and software problems Assisting users with issues related to desktops, laptops, printers, and mobile devices Providing step-by-step guidance over the phone, via email, or using remote support tools 2. User Account Management Creating, modifying, or disabling user accounts in systems like Active Directory or Microsoft 365 Resetting passwords and managing access rights 3. Ticket Management Logging and tracking support requests through a ticketing system Prioritizing and escalating issues based on severity and service-level agreements (SLAs) Updating tickets with troubleshooting steps and resolutions 4. Software Installation and Updates Installing approved applications and ensuring compliance with company policies Running system updates and ensuring antivirus software is active and updated 5. Documentation Creating knowledge base articles and guides for common issues Recording troubleshooting processes and solutions for future reference Soft Skills Are Just as Important In addition to technical ability, soft skills are crucial for success in an IT helpdesk role: Communication: You’ll need to explain technical concepts clearly to non-technical users. Patience: Users may be frustrated—staying calm and empathetic is key. Problem-Solving: Every issue is different. You’ll need to think critically to find efficient solutions. Time Management: Handling multiple tickets or calls simultaneously requires strong organizational skills. Tools You’ll Likely Use Familiarity with the following tools will give you a head start: Ticketing systems like Zendesk, Freshdesk, or ServiceNow Remote desktop tools like TeamViewer or AnyDesk Email platforms like Microsoft 365 or Google Workspace Directory services like Active Directory or Azure AD Basic scripting tools (PowerShell, Bash) for advanced troubleshooting Certifications That Can Boost Your Resume While many entry-level roles don’t require formal certifications, having one or more of the following can give you an edge: CompTIA A+: Covers core IT concepts and troubleshooting Google IT Support Certificate: Offers foundational IT support skills Microsoft Certified: Azure Fundamentals: Useful for cloud-focused environments ITIL 4 Foundation: Introduces IT service management best practices Career Path from IT Helpdesk An IT helpdesk role is a gateway to multiple career opportunities, including: Network or Systems Administration IT Security and Compliance Cloud Engineering or DevOps Technical Account Management or Customer Success By gaining hands-on experience with real-world issues, helpdesk technicians develop a well-rounded understanding of IT systems—making it easier to specialize and grow within the industry. What Employers Look for in Entry-Level IT Helpdesk Candidates A basic understanding of computer systems and networking Strong communication and customer service skills Willingness to learn and adapt Ability to follow technical instructions Enthusiasm for problem-solving and technology A degree in IT or computer science can help, but many employers prioritize skills and practical experience—especially if supported by relevant certifications. Final Thoughts Your first IT helpdesk job is more than just a support role—it’s a launchpad. You’ll learn to troubleshoot real problems, gain exposure to various IT environments, and build relationships with both users and technical teams. With the right attitude, training, and support, an IT helpdesk role can open doors to a rewarding and upward-moving career in technology. How to Optimise IT Helpdesk Performance with Automation

As IT environments become more complex and user expectations rise, the traditional helpdesk model is often stretched thin. Slow ticket resolution, repetitive tasks, and overwhelmed support staff can lead to poor user experiences and mounting operational costs. Enter IT Helpdesk Automation—a transformative approach that improves efficiency, reduces manual workload, and enhances service delivery. By automating routine tasks and workflows, businesses can free up technicians to focus on more strategic, high-value support. In this guide, White Label Service Desk explores how to optimise IT helpdesk performance using automation, the types of tasks you can automate, and the measurable benefits it delivers. Why Automate the IT Helpdesk? Automation isn’t about replacing your IT team—it’s about empowering them. When implemented thoughtfully, helpdesk automation streamlines processes, improves consistency, and accelerates response times. Key Benefits: Faster Ticket Resolution: Automation helps triage, categorize, and even resolve tickets instantly. Reduced Human Error: Predefined workflows ensure accuracy in task execution. Improved User Experience: Quicker responses and self-service options increase satisfaction. Cost Savings: More issues resolved without human intervention means fewer resources are required. Scalability: Handle increased ticket volume without needing to proportionally scale headcount. Key Areas of Helpdesk Automation 1. Ticket Triage and Routing Automate the classification and assignment of incoming tickets based on keywords, user roles, or issue types. For example: Direct hardware issues to the infrastructure team Assign password resets to a bot or Tier 0 solution Prioritize VIP tickets for faster response 2. Self-Service Portals Empower users to resolve common issues without contacting support: Password resets Software installations Account unlocks Access requests When integrated with a knowledge base or chatbot, self-service can resolve a large volume of Tier 1 tickets before they ever reach a technician. 3. Automated Workflows Create predefined workflows for repeatable processes, such as: Onboarding/offboarding employees (creating or disabling accounts, assigning permissions) Provisioning software licenses Scheduled system updates or backups These workflows reduce manual intervention and improve consistency across teams. 4. Notifications and Escalations Automation tools can trigger alerts or escalate tickets when service-level agreements (SLAs) are at risk. This ensures no ticket falls through the cracks and helps maintain performance standards. 5. Chatbots and AI Assistants Chatbots can handle FAQs, open tickets, check status updates, and even perform basic troubleshooting. With natural language processing (NLP), they can understand user intent and provide helpful responses 24/7. 6. Performance Analytics and Reporting Automated dashboards and reports provide real-time visibility into key metrics like ticket volume, resolution time, technician workload, and SLA compliance. These insights allow managers to make data-driven decisions and continuously improve. Best Practices for Implementing Helpdesk Automation 1. Start Small Begin with high-volume, low-complexity tasks like password resets or ticket categorization. This allows your team to build confidence and measure early results. 2. Integrate with Existing Tools Ensure your automation platform integrates with your ITSM system, Active Directory, and communication tools (like Teams or Slack) for seamless operation. 3. Involve Your Team Get feedback from technicians and end-users to identify pain points that could be resolved through automation. 4. Maintain a Human Touch Not every ticket can—or should—be automated. Maintain a clear escalation path to live support when human judgment is needed. 5. Monitor and Iterate Track automation performance regularly. Review which automations save time and which may need improvement. Automation is most effective when continuously optimized. Measuring the Impact of Helpdesk Automation Success in automation isn’t just about the number of bots—it’s about measurable outcomes. Consider tracking: Reduction in average ticket resolution time Decrease in technician workload for repetitive tasks Increase in first-contact resolution rate End-user satisfaction scores SLA adherence rate improvement Final Thoughts Automation has become a must-have capability for high-performing IT helpdesks. When used strategically, it reduces operational friction, improves user satisfaction, and gives your support team the capacity to focus on more valuable initiatives. From chatbots to automated workflows and intelligent ticket routing, the potential of IT helpdesk automation is vast—and well within reach for organizations of any size. Achieve Cyber Essentials Compliance Today

For UK businesses, achieving a recognised cybersecurity certification is increasingly important—not just for compliance, but to build client trust and meet contractual requirements. The Cyber Essentials scheme, backed by the UK government and the National Cyber Security Centre (NCSC), offers two certification levels:Cyber Essentials and Cyber Essentials Plus. Though they share the same core objectives, these certifications differ significantly in how they’re assessed and the level of assurance they provide. Understanding the distinctions between the two can help businesses determine the most appropriate certification based on their operations, risk profile, and client expectations. An Overview of Cyber Essentials Cyber Essentials is a foundational cybersecurity certification. It provides a simple but effective framework for businesses to protect themselves against common threats. The certification focuses on five technical controls: Firewalls and boundary security Secure configuration of devices and software User access controls Malware protection Regular software updates and patch management Cyber Essentials is a self-assessment certification. After reviewing your security practices internally, you submit a questionnaire to a certification body for review. This makes it accessible and suitable for smaller businesses or those starting to formalize their security processes. Key Benefits of Cyber Essentials: Demonstrates a proactive approach to basic cybersecurity Helps meet minimum security requirements for some government contracts Provides a cost-effective starting point for improving IT governance Enhances reputation with clients and partners What Sets Cyber Essentials Plus Apart? Cyber Essentials Plus includes all the requirements of the standard Cyber Essentials certification but adds a significant layer of assurance through independent testing. A qualified assessor conducts a technical audit of your systems to validate that your controls are correctly implemented and functioning as expected. This includes: External and internal vulnerability scans Testing of endpoint configurations Verification of patch status and antivirus solutions Checks on access control and user privileges Why Choose Cyber Essentials Plus? Provides external verification of security practices Offers a higher level of credibility for regulated industries Often required for more complex or sensitive government contracts Reassures stakeholders with a third-party-reviewed security framework Comparing the Two: A Summary Criteria Cyber Essentials Cyber Essentials Plus Assessment Method Self-assessed Independently audited Technical Testing No Yes Certification Time 1–3 days (on average) 5–10 days (depending on readiness) Level of Assurance Basic Advanced Cost Lower Higher Typical Use Case SMEs or early-stage security initiatives Businesses with sensitive data or strict compliance needs How to Decide Between the Two The choice between Cyber Essentials and Cyber Essentials Plus depends on your business goals and the environments in which you operate. Opt for Cyber Essentials if: You need a quick, affordable way to demonstrate basic security readiness You’re pursuing contracts with minimal security compliance requirements Your IT environment is simple and well-documented Opt for Cyber Essentials Plus if: You handle sensitive data or deliver services in regulated sectors You want a third-party assessment to confirm your controls are effective Your clients or contracts require externally verified cybersecurity standards Final Thoughts Cyber Essentials and Cyber Essentials Plus are both effective tools for improving your organisation’s cybersecurity posture. The first helps establish a baseline. The second validates that your systems work as intended under scrutiny. For businesses aiming to win public sector contracts, work in finance or healthcare, or provide managed IT services, Cyber Essentials Plus often delivers the assurance needed to meet expectations and build trust. IT Infrastructure as a Service (IaaS): Benefits and Applications

In the rapidly evolving world of cloud computing, IT Infrastructure as a Service (IaaS) has emerged as a cornerstone of digital transformation. Whether you’re a startup aiming to scale quickly or an enterprise modernising its legacy systems, IaaS provides the agility, efficiency, and scalability needed to compete in today’s digital economy. In this guide, White Label Service Desk breaks down what is IaaS, explore its business benefits, and offer a practical roadmap for successful implementation. What is Infrastructure as a Service (IaaS)? IaaS is a cloud computing model that delivers fundamental IT resources—including servers, storage, networking, and virtualization—over the internet. Instead of investing in physical infrastructure, businesses can rent computing power and storage from a cloud provider on a pay-as-you-go basis. Leading IaaS providers include Amazon Web Services (AWS), Microsoft Azure, and Google Cloud Platform (GCP), though many white-label solutions and private cloud options also exist for resellers and MSPs. Key Components of IaaS Compute: Virtual machines and processing power for hosting applications and running workloads Storage: Scalable cloud storage for files, databases, and backups Networking: Virtual networks, firewalls, load balancers, and IP address management Virtualisation: Resource pooling and hypervisors for isolating workloads Security & Monitoring: Identity management, encryption, and usage analytics Benefits of IaaS for Businesses 1. Cost Savings IaaS eliminates the capital expenses of purchasing and maintaining physical hardware. With a usage-based billing model, businesses only pay for the resources they consume, significantly reducing IT overhead. 2. Scalability and Flexibility Need to handle seasonal traffic spikes or launch a new application? IaaS allows you to scale up or down within minutes, providing unmatched flexibility and responsiveness to business needs. 3. Faster Time to Market With infrastructure ready to deploy, businesses can launch projects faster without waiting for hardware procurement or setup. This accelerates innovation and reduces the time between concept and execution. 4. Enhanced Business Continuity IaaS providers offer robust backup and disaster recovery options, ensuring that critical services remain available even in the face of hardware failures or outages. 5. Focus on Core Competencies By outsourcing infrastructure management, IT teams can focus on higher-value tasks like software development, user support, and business strategy, rather than day-to-day server maintenance. 6. Global Reach Major IaaS platforms offer data centers around the world, enabling businesses to deploy services closer to end-users for reduced latency and improved performance. Common Use Cases for IaaS Hosting websites and applications Disaster recovery and backup Development and test environments Big data processing and analytics High-performance computing (HPC) Business continuity planning Challenges to Consider While IaaS offers numerous benefits, successful adoption requires addressing certain challenges: Security and Compliance: Businesses must ensure data is encrypted, access is controlled, and compliance regulations (e.g., GDPR, HIPAA) are met. Vendor Lock-in: Relying on a single provider may complicate future migrations or integrations. Management Complexity: Without proper oversight, costs and resources can quickly spiral due to uncontrolled usage. Implementation Guide: How to Deploy IaaS Successfully 1. Assess Your Needs Begin by identifying your infrastructure requirements—compute, storage, bandwidth, and security. Understand your business objectives and workloads to design a solution that meets your needs. 2. Choose the Right Provider Evaluate providers based on performance, pricing, support, data center locations, and integration capabilities. Consider both public cloud giants and white-label or private cloud solutions for greater flexibility. 3. Design a Scalable Architecture Work with cloud architects to create a scalable, fault-tolerant infrastructure. Leverage automation tools for provisioning and management, and integrate monitoring tools for visibility. 4. Establish Security Protocols Implement Identity and Access management (IAM), multi-factor authentication, encryption, and compliance measures. Secure APIs and regularly audit access rights. 5. Plan for Migration Develop a phased migration strategy to move from on-premises infrastructure to the cloud. Prioritize non-critical systems first, and test each phase thoroughly. 6. Monitor and Optimise After deployment, continuously monitor performance, usage, and costs. Use analytics to identify inefficiencies and implement auto-scaling to optimize resource allocation. Final Thoughts Infrastructure as a Service (IaaS) is transforming how businesses deploy and manage IT resources. It provides the agility, scalability, and cost-effectiveness needed to stay competitive in a digital-first world. However, successful IaaS adoption requires thoughtful planning, careful provider selection, and robust governance. When done right, IaaS can power your growth and innovation without the complexity of managing hardware.
